Volkswagen Golf Service & Repair Manual: Layout - multi-function steering wheel

For a better usability of infotainment, telephone, navigation, cruise control system and vehicle menu, buttons are integrated in steering wheel. For Tiptronic, additional rocker switches are provided to the right and to the left.
The control unit for multifunction steering wheel -J453- (multifunction buttons on left in steering wheel -E440-) reads the button information and transfers them to control unit for steering column electronics -J527- via LIN data bus. From control unit for steering column electronics -J527- the data are transferred to the individual devices via CAN bus (comfort) and data bus diagnostic interface -J533-.
Fault finding is done via Guided fault finding → Vehicle diagnostic tester.
